About Hex Color #0A1AC0
The hexadecimal color code #0A1AC0 represents a specific point in the blue color spectrum. In the RGB (Red, Green, Blue) color model, it is composed of 4% red, 10.2% green, and 75.3% blue. This indicates a dominant presence of blue, resulting in a dark, saturated shade. In the C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Black) color model, it is composed of 95% cyan, 86% magenta, 0% yellow, and 25% black. This suggests that the color is primarily formed by cyan and magenta inks. The color has a wavelength of approximately 467.72 nm. It's commonly categorized as a dark blue. The color #0A1AC0, a deep dark blue, presents several accessibility considerations, particularly in web design. When used as a background color, it requires light-colored text to ensure sufficient contrast. A cont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 is recommended for standard text and 3:1 for large text to meet WCAG (Web Content Accessibility Guidelines) AA standards. Using a color contrast checker can help determine appropriate text colors. Avoid using this color for small text or crucial interface elements without careful consideration of contrast. When used for links, ensure they are visually distinguishable from surrounding text through additional styling (e.g., underline, bolding) to aid users with color vision deficiencies. The darkness of this color may also affect users with low vision, so providing options for users to adjust the color scheme is a good practice.

Applications
Website Header/Footer
Dark blues evoke feelings of trust, security, and stability. In web design, #0A1AC0 can be used for the header or footer of a website to create a sense of authority and reliability. It's suitable for websites in the finance, technology, or healthcare industries. Using it as a background for calls to action with white or yellow text can create a sophisticated and professional look. However, avoid overuse to prevent a somber or overwhelming feel.
Fashion Design
In fashion, dark blue, like #0A1AC0, is a versatile and classic color. It can be used for formal wear, such as suits or evening dresses, providing a sophisticated and elegant appearance. It also works well for casual wear, such as jeans or sweaters. Dark blue can be paired with a variety of colors, including white, gray, and even brighter hues like yellow or pink, to create different looks. It can be an alternative to black, offering a softer, yet equally elegant touch.
Interior Design
This color can be effectively used as an accent color in interior design, bringing depth and a sense of calm to a space. Consider using it for accent walls in living rooms or bedrooms, paired with lighter neutrals such as beige or light gray. It also works well for upholstery on furniture like sofas or armchairs, creating a sophisticated and inviting atmosphere. Metallic accents such as gold or silver can enhance the richness of the dark blue.
